Overview Voice over LTE (VoLTE) is a groundbreaking technology that has revolutionized the way voice calls are made on mobile networks. By leveraging the capabilities of 4G LTE networks, VoLTE offers a superior user experience with enhanced audio quality, faster call setup times, and a wide range of advanced features. As the demand for high-quality voice communication continues to grow, the Voice over LTE (VoLTE) market has witnessed significant expansion in recent years. Voice over LTE (VoLTE) Market Drivers Several factors are driving the growth of the VoLTE market: Improved voice quality: VoLTE delivers significantly better voice quality than traditional 2G and 3G networks, leading to a more satisfying user experience. Faster call setup times: VoLTE calls are established much faster than traditional voice calls, reducing call latency and improving overall user satisfaction. Enhanced features: VoLTE enables a range of advanced features, such as HD voice, video calling, and the ability to seamlessly switch between voice and data services. Overview The Passive Optical LAN (POL) market is a growing sector within the telecommunications industry. POL is a network technology that utilizes optical fiber to connect end devices like computers, servers, and IP phones to a central switch or router. Unlike traditional Ethernet networks, POL eliminates the need for active devices between the central node and end devices, resulting in a more efficient and reliable network architecture. Passive Optical LAN (POL) Market Drivers Several factors are driving the growth of the POL market: Demand for high-speed networks: The increasing demand for high-speed data transmission, especially in enterprise and commercial environments, is a significant driver for POL adoption. Energy efficiency: POL networks consume less power compared to traditional Ethernet networks, making them an attractive option for organizations looking to reduce their energy footprint. Scalability: POL networks are highly scalable, allowing for easy expansion and accommodating future growth. Reliability: The passive nature of POL networks makes them more resilient to failures and less susceptible to downtime. Cost-effectiveness: In the long term, POL can be a cost-effective solution due to its lower operational and maintenance costs. Haptic Interface Market Overview A haptic interface is a device that provides tactile feedback to the user through touch, vibration, or force. This feedback enhances the user experience by creating a more immersive and realistic interaction with digital content. The haptic interface market has been gaining traction in recent years due to advancements in technology and increasing demand for more interactive and engaging user experiences. Haptic Interface Market Drivers Several factors are driving the growth of the haptic interface market: Advancements in technology: The development of more sophisticated haptic actuators and sensors has made it possible to create more realistic and nuanced haptic experiences. Increasing demand for immersive experiences: Users are seeking more immersive experiences across various industries, including gaming, virtual reality, and healthcare. Haptic interfaces can significantly enhance these experiences. Growth of wearable devices: The popularity of wearable devices such as smartwatches and fitness trackers has created new opportunities for haptic interfaces to provide tactile feedback for notifications and other functions. Integration with other technologies: Haptic interfaces can be integrated with other technologies, such as augmented reality and artificial intelligence, to create more comprehensive and interactive experiences.
